About

Calton Hill is a mountain located in england east midlands. Elevation: 400 m. A named British peak recorded in OpenStreetMap. Peaks are typically named on Ordnance Survey 1:50k mapping.

Frequently asked questions

Where is Calton Hill?
Calton Hill is in Derbyshire, the East Midlands, United Kingdom (postcode SK17 9TG), in the parish of Blackwell in the Peak.
What is Calton Hill?
Calton Hill β€” mountain in england east midlands. Elevation: 400 m.
How do I get to Calton Hill?
The nearest railway station is Buxton, about 6.4 km away. Drivers can use postcode SK17 9TG.
Is Calton Hill a protected site?
Yes β€” Calton Hill is part of the Calton Hill SSSI Site of Special Scientific Interest and the The Wye Valley SSSI Site of Special Scientific Interest.
